Q: What set of blood vessels carry blood from the heart to all parts of the body except the lungs and back to the heart?

Which blood vessels carry deoygenated blood?

In all cases except one, veins carry deoxygenated blood. The exception is the pulmonary veins which carry oxygenated blood to the heart from the lungs. Veins ALWAYS carry blood to the heart.
